how do I know where the seals are positioned?Not unknown but not at all necessary so really it is just a matter of finding out where the water is getting in and sealing the leak.
Best way is to have someone play a hosepipe over the front of the vehicle (concentrating on the screen & flaps) and you have a good poke around the inside with a torch, water can run a long way and follow unseen paths so it may take a while but should be very possible to successfully sort out.
Obvious things are things like windscreen seal, windscreen-frame to bulkhead seal, windscreen-frame bracket / hinge gaskets, flap seals, door-seals. Of course don't forget that if water is getting under the bonnet onto the footwells (rubber seal missing between bulkhead & rear of bonnet?) then it could be entering through the pedal mountings.

The water usually comes in on mine from the gap round the bulkhead seal. It runs round the inside or just behind dash and down the footwell and pedals.
Just needs sealing. Then you will find the next leak lol
